  1. Sidney Stone Blumenthal (born November 6, 1948) is an American journalist, political operative, and Lincoln scholar. A former aide to President Bill Clinton, he is a long-time confidant [1] of Hillary Clinton and was formerly employed by the Clinton Foundation.
